News from the mainland universities

UiO: All trial lectures and public defenses must be held at UiO.

NTNU (Faculty of Engineering Science and Technology) has made a new web-page with all forms and templates. This is found at http://www.ntnu.edu/ivt/phd/forms

UiT: New PhD regulations in force by 01.01.13. These are found at

http://uit.no/ansatte/organisasjon/artikkel?p_document_id=324228&p_dimension_id=88163&p_m enu=28713 (Norwegian), and

http://uit.no/Content/327454/Ph%20d%20-forskrift%202012%20-%20engelsk.pdf (English) The new regulations will apply to all PhD-students, also those admitted before 2013. An important

(2)

change is that master courses can no longer be part of the training component (cf. § 15). However, if the candidates already have an approved plan for their training component, this will still be valid.

New supplementary regulations will be in force by 01.04.13. These are not yet published online.
